The New South Wales Rod Fishers' Society  Library

One of the Society's principal assets is its specialist library containing fishing memorabilia and most of the classic Australian and New Zealand fly fishing books. The library is almost as old as the Society itself and has grown through the years by both purchase and donation.

 

Most books in the library are available for loan to members. Borrowed books can either be collected from the Honorary Secretary or sent out to members through the post and returned the same way. Borrowing costs only apply to those members who request that books be sent out to them by post and these are limited to the actual costs of postage and insurance.

Photographic Archive

The New South Wales Rod Fishers' Society is assembling an archive of historical fishing photographs. These photographs will be placed with our other valuable historic archives of Gazettes, Journals and Bulletins held at the State Library of New South Wales. Tight Lines

Members are kept in touch with our two publications: Tight Lines Bulletin, which is published four times each year, and the Tight Lines Journal which is an annual.

 

The Bulletin is edited by Ken Musgrove and keeps members informed of current and future events, guest speakers, Field Programs and reports on recent trips.

 

The Tight Lines Journal is edited by Geoff King and has a magazine format. It contains articles by members and about members, past and present, articles on history, and fishing adventures here and overseas.

The Flowing Stream

The Flowing Stream is our major hard-cover publication celebrating the formation of Rod Fishers in 1904, the dedication of our founders, our efforts and achievements and the pleasures and mateship of fishing, glimpsed through the pages of our journals over the past 100 years.

 

It is published in a Limited Edition of 1,000 individually certified copies.

 

The book includes a history of the Society and 75 fascinating extracts and numerous photographs and illustrations from our journals and archives.
